1. DRONEQUBE

  • Founding Year: 2023
  • Location: Dover, US
  • Use For: Autonomous Vineyard Management

US-based startup DRONEQUBE provides a robotic UAV station and drones for vineyard owners to autonomously monitor and safeguard crop health.

The weatherproof robotic UAV station refills pesticides and charges batteries for drones. These drones leverage advanced data analytics, AI-driven anomaly detection, and precision spraying techniques to address the impacts of global warming on vineyard yields.

 

 

Further, this technology records and integrates vegetation indices, thermal data, and weather sensor information to provide comprehensive vineyard insights. DRONEQUBE digitizes crop health monitoring and protection for cost-effective and timely interventions.

2. Cellar Insights

  • Founding Year: 2023
  • Location: Calgary, Canada
  • Use For: Potato Storage Monitoring

Canadian startup Cellar Insights utilizes smart remote monitoring to maximize the value of potato crops in storage. It employs sensors and cloud-based algorithms to remotely monitor potato health as conventional daily facility visits are not convenient.

This solution provides crop owners with actionable insights via mobile devices to detect early signs of rot and other storage conditions, such as temperature, humidity, and carbon dioxide, that put crop yield and quality at risk.

Moreover, it enables them to customize the ideal facility conditions and get instant notification if the conditions shift out of range. Cellar Insights helps potato growers improve the management of facility conditions and take timely action to maximize yield and quality.

3. Pestevene

  • Founding Year: 2023
  • Location: Ropazi, Latvia
  • Use For: Pore Forming Proteins (PPFs)

Latvian startup Pestevene modifies plants to produce a specific type of pore-forming protein that acts as a biopesticide for integrated protection against major pests. These proteins are derived from an edible oyster mushroom, which forms pores in the pest’s cell membrane by targeting an insect lipid.

The lipid interaction ensures efficacy to hold in the long-term which is an important quality for pesticide active ingredients. Pestevene provides long-term plant protection, improves crop pest resistance, and supports sustainable farming practices.

4. Plantvoice

  • Founding Year: 2023
  • Location: Bolzano, Italy
  • Use For: Smart Graft

Italian startup Plantvoice offers a smart graft to monitor and assess the health of fruit plants. The system consists of a phyto-compatible device, which is inserted into the plant stem and allows real-time monitoring of salinity and sap flows.

 

 

This device transmits the collected internal physiological data of plants to an AI-based software, which processes them in the cloud through advanced algorithms. This allows farmers to proactively identify signs of water stress, recognize early attacks by pathogens, and analyze the plant’s response to agronomic treatments.

Unlike conventional technologies, this solution performs an analysis directly from inside the plant, making the diagnosis more timely and precise. Plantvoice SB helps farmers predict the quality of agricultural production and maximize crop yields.

5. Plense Technologies

  • Founding Year: 2023
  • Location: Delft, Netherlands
  • Use For: Smart Sensing Devices

Dutch startup Plense Technologies builds smart sensing devices to detect early signs of stress in plants. It utilizes ultrasound technology to listen to plants and convert crop status into actionable data.

This solution leverages advanced algorithms and AI to translate acoustic data into information such as water uptake, stress, and recovery. This active method monitors plant reactions early and in real time.

 

 

Further, it provides insights into how crops respond to biotic or abiotic changes and helps farmers take action to improve their strategies, such as irrigation and energy. The startup empowers growers to make informed, data-driven decisions about their precious crops.

6. Soil Biotect

  • Founding Year: 2023
  • Location: Polanica-Zdrój, Poland
  • Use For: Liquid Microorganisms

Polish startup Soil Biotect produces liquid microorganisms to eliminate the spread of fungal phytopathogens in agricultural crops. This product contains two species of bacteria from the genus Bacillus amyloliquefaciens and subtilis.

Further, it allows farmers to inject it into the soil around the root ball or spray the surface of the leaves. This enables the release of macro and micro nutrients like phosphorus and potassium and increases the nitrogen binding in the soil. Soil Biotect enables higher yields and greater crop efficiency with significant reduction of synthetic fertilizers and protection.

7. Agrican

  • Founding Year: 2023
  • Location: Mansoura, Egypt
  • Use For: Plant Disease Identification Drone

Egyptian startup Agrican provides a plant disease identification drone for advanced crop health monitoring. Through imaging technology, the startup proactively identifies plant diseases, enabling timely intervention and treatment.

The high-resolution cameras provide detailed aerial views of the fields, allowing for meticulous monitoring of crop health. Further, this solution integrates AI and machine learning to analyze crop data, providing valuable insights for informed decision-making.

Early detection of issues helps farmers reduce the excessive use of pesticides, aligning with sustainable farming practices. Agrican enables farmers to boost crop health and save time and resources while aligning with sustainable farming practices.

8. AgroSync

  • Founding Year: 2023
  • Location: Vilnius, Lithuania
  • Use For: Satellite Crop Analysis Platform

Lithuanian startup AgroSync builds a satellite crop analysis platform to monitor crop health and optimize yields with customized precision tools. This technology helps farmers save on fertilizer, improve efficiency, and reduce costs.

Moreover, it uses satellite data to develop variable rate application fertilization maps that show exactly where and how much fertilizer to use in different parts of the field.

The tools help them to develop these maps quickly. AgroSync provides farmers with up-to-date information on soil health, climate conditions, plant wellness, and pest management.

9. TransAlgae

  • Founding Year: 2023
  • Location: Rehovoth, Israel
  • Use For: Microalgae Platform

Israeli startup TransAlgae develops a proprietary microalgae platform for the delivery of biological-based insecticides to be sprayed on crops. It enables targeting particular insects in a specific manner, replacing the need for toxic chemicals.

 

 

Furthermore, the technology sprays crops with inactivated algal powder that delivers a targeted biological molecule. This targeted molecule eliminates the pest and decomposes quickly rather than amassing in runoff. TransAlgae enables crop health protection by replacing the need for toxic chemical spraying to protect crops.

10. Vinebotics

  • Founding Year: 2024
  • Location: Napa, US
  • Use For: Sustainable Viticulture

US-based startup Vinebotics utilizes UV-C lighting technology and artificial intelligence to provide sustainable and efficient vineyard management. Their innovative approach, powered by clean electric energy and air robotics, ensures sustainable cultivation, superior pest control, and enhanced crop health.

The robots meticulously care for vines, ensuring they are free from harmful pathogens such as mold, fungus, pests, and bacteria. Further, their intelligent systems analyze vast amounts of data to make informed decisions, optimizing the health and productivity of each vine. Vinebotics’ AI-driven insights and UV-C sterilization boost crop resilience and yield.
